Mad(d)er, Malder, Maider, Mather, n. Also: mad(d)ir, -yr, -ur; maldir, maulder; maydr; maither, mether, meather. [ME. mader, -re, madder, e.m.E. mather, OE. mædere, mæddre (ON. maðra).]
The root of the plant, madder, as a commodity; the dyestuff prepared from this.(a) 14.. Acts I. 304/2.
